Mother to five year old and 3 month old sons, Twenty-six year old Lindsay McKeever’s life changed forever on January 21st 2012 when she was hospitalized with toxic shock syndrome. With her blood pressure at 30/50, oxygen level 50%, kidneys incomplete failure and in a coma, she was given little chance of surviving. But miraculously one week later, against all odds, she came out of her coma and slowly made her way back to the living. Because most of her organs began to shut down during the week she was in the coma, her hands and feet turned black and she had to have all her fingers and toes amputated. She was released from the hospital March 13th and has to have care 24 hours a day. She is unable to walk, or take care of herself in any way, not to mention the care she needs for her children. With no insurance Lindsay needs help to pay for physical therapy to learn to walk again and to do small things like feed herself, etc. A care fund has been set up for her by US Bank in Iowa and a paypal account for donations. Abby Morgan has an ability to hear the dead. Little did she know the Victorian she just rented came with it’s own ghost, Duke Rivers. Having died thirty years prior Duke needs Abby’s aid in solving his murder so he can cross into the light. Teaming up with Duke’s nephew, Owen, finding the killer seemed like a good plan until they uncover secrets that could blow Hunters Hollow wide apart
